This mission made me adore this racer. Great noise and utterly sublime handling on the unexpectedly tricky Sarthe Circuit
I did cut a few corners here by accident a few times. The high rate of acceleration and speed plays havoc of knowing when to turn. A few tips:
When going into the Dunlop Chicane, start braking the moment you fly past the blue & white turning sign (that's on the right-hand wall) just before the chicane, and accelerate out when you reach the first apex.
Never ever try to take the inside line when passing a car on the Mulsanne corner. It's better to start this corner from an extremely wide angle. The ideal speed here is about 90km/h, but it can be done at 100km/h if you use all of the pavement.
The Porsche Curves are tricky to do fast in an automatic. I think the best way is to listen to the revs. The low end of 4th is faster, but the high end of 3rd gear gives you that extra bit of control, that the low end of 4th gear doesn't.
The gear down indicator for the Ford Chicanes comes up a little too early. Start braking the moment you approach the rumble strips on the right. Then for the second chicane brake to about 110km/h.
For the most part the track surface is uneven, which will cause the car to bounce a lot. The Mulsanne straight in particular is quite bouncy, and the car does change direction ever so slightly. If you're extremely gentle with the steering you can keep the car under control.

Don't tell me you're going to use the 2J at LeMans. I'm telling you it's unlikely. There is no suspension setting that allows the 2J to track straight near the end of Mulsanne. It's too bumpy. I've tried everything and the 2J is of no use at Sarthe. The 2J needs a smooth, flat, short course to do it's thing. If it only had four speeds instead of three it would have doubled it's usefulness in GT4.
